Frequently Asked Questions
What is the average Chefs and Head Cooks salary in Michigan?
The mean chefs and head cooks salary in Michigan is $59,170 per year. The median (middle) salary is $58,430 per year. Source: BLS OEWS 2024.
What is the starting salary for a Chefs and Head Cooks in Michigan?
Entry-level chefs and head cookss (10th percentile) in Michigan typically earn around $38,730 per year. Workers at the 25th percentile earn approximately $49,350 per year.
What is the highest Chefs and Head Cooks salary in Michigan?
Top earners (90th percentile) in this occupation in Michigan make approximately $77,030 per year. Those in the 75th percentile earn around $64,980 per year.
How does the Michigan Chefs and Head Cooks salary compare to the national average?
The median chefs and head cooks salary in Michigan is $58,430, which is -4% below national average of $60,990.
